KOCCA Philippines Opening Ceremony Bid Announcement (URGENT)
- Post Date2026-09-08
- attached file

1. Tender Overview
ㅇ Bid Title : Commissioned Services for the KOCCA Philippines Opening Ceremony and Pre-Opening Promotional Activities
ㅇ Project Scope : See the Request for Proposal (RFP).
ㅇ Service Period: From contract signing until December 20, 2026
ㅇ Estimated Contract Value : PHP 2,526,786
ㅇ Project Budget : PHP 2,830,000 (including VAT and withholding tax)

4. Bidder Selection Method
ㅇ Bidding Method : Restricted Competition / Lump-Sum Bidding
ㅇ Contracting Method : Contract by Negotiation (in accordance with Article 43 of the Enforcement Decree of the Act on Contracts to Which the State Is a Party)
- Evaluation Method : Technical Proposal+Price, Comprehensive Evaluation (Proposal:Price = 90:10)
ㅇ The evaluation schedule will be announced separately after the deadline for submission of proposals. Bidders shall submit, together with the proposal, presentation materials in PPT or PDF format summarizing the contents of the proposal. The presentation materials must be submitted in a version with all information identifying the bidder removed.
5. Eligibility to Participate in the Tender
ㅇ Pursuant to Article 14 of the「 Regulations on the Operation of Contract Affairs of Other Public Institutions 」, Article 27 of the「Act on Contracts to Which the State Is a Party 」, and Article 76 of the Enforcement Decree of the Act on Contracts to Which the State Is a Party, the bidder must not fall under any of the following categories: (i) a person or entity clearly determined to be likely to impair fair competition or the proper performance of the contract; or (ii) a person or entity whose eligibility to participate in a tender has been restricted as an improper business entity.
ㅇ Businesses with their principal place of business in the Philippines
※ Any bid submitted by a bidder that does not meet the qualifications specified above will be deemed invalid.

◎ Other Matters
ㅇ Any person or entity intending to participate in the tender shall fully familiarize themselves, prior to submitting a bid, with all matters necessary for the tender, including the Request for Proposal (RFP) and any other relevant documents. The bidder shall bear full responsibility for any failure to familiarize themselves with such matters.
ㅇ If any information contained in the submitted documents is found to be false or exaggerated (including, but not limited to, cases where the monthly participation rate of assigned personnel exceeds 100%), the bidder may be excluded from the evaluation, and the contract may be cancelled or terminated. The bidder shall be liable for any damages arising therefrom.
* Regarding the Calculation of Labor Costs for Assigned Personnel
- Personnel assigned to this project shall have a monthly participation rate of at least 30% during the project performance period (with a participation rate of 0% for any month in which the personnel do not participate). The total participation rate, including participation in all other projects being performed, shall not exceed 100%.
